Synthesis, characterization, spectroscopy, electronic and redox properties of a new nickel dithiolene system
Partha Basu1, Archana Nigam, Benjamin Mogesa
1Department of Chemistry and Biochemistry, Duquesne University, Pittsburgh, PA 15282.
Abstract:
A new dithiolene ligand with 3,5-dibromo substituted phenyl groups was designed and synthesized. The protected form of the ligand was reacted with a nickel salt providing neutral Ni(S(2)C(2)(3,5-C(6)H(3)Br(2))(2))(2) and anionic [Ni(S(2)C(2)(3,5-C(6)H(3)Br(2))(2))(2)](-) isolated as a Bu(4)N(+) salt. Both were characterized by UV-visible and IR spectroscopy and compared with the similar known molecular systems. They exhibit intense low-energy transitions that are characteristic of such systems. The electrochemical behavior of these molecules was investigated by cyclic voltammetry.
